dc.description.abstractThe effect of Cotula cinerae extract on the corrosion rates of mild steel X52 in 20% H2SO4 solution has been elucidated at 25 C° by potentiodynamic polarization method. The maximum inhibition efficiency (%ηPol) was about 95 %. As far as we know, the anticorrosive behavior of this plant has never been undertaken in literature.en_US
